Core Viewpoint - The article emphasizes the development of non-grain biomass resources for energy and bio-based materials, highlighting the upcoming NFUCon 2025 forum aimed at discussing commercialization paths and technological advancements in this sector [2]. Group 1: Forum Overview - The NFUCon 2025 will be held from November 27-29, 2025, in Hangzhou, Zhejiang, organized by DT New Materials and the National Key Laboratory of Bio-based Transportation Fuels [2][3]. - The forum will gather industry representatives and experts to explore key areas such as green pretreatment of biomass, non-grain sugars, bio-based chemicals and materials, and biomass energy [2][4]. Group 2: Forum Agenda - The forum will feature two main thematic forums: - The first focuses on non-grain bio-based chemicals and materials, including sessions on biomass green pretreatment, non-grain sugars, and bio-based chemicals [6][9]. - The second thematic forum will address non-grain biomass energy, covering topics like biomass methanol, fuel ethanol, biogas, and sustainable aviation fuel (SAF) [9][10]. Group 3: Supporting Units and Participants - The forum is supported by various institutions, including Zhejiang University and its relevant departments, as well as editorial boards of related journals [4]. - Participants will include production enterprises in biomass energy and chemicals, academic experts, and solution providers in biomass processing technologies [14]. Group 4: Special Activities - A special activity for technology achievement display and matchmaking will be held, aiming to promote innovation and commercialization in the biomass sector [9]. - The forum will showcase 50 innovative projects with commercial potential in biomass utilization [9].
